In the period from September 2019 to September 2021, I participated in „The European Program for Intervention Epidemiology Training“ (EPIET) in the Czech Republic, i.e. the EU country of my nationality and citizenship, the so-called Member State track (MS-track). I worked at the Department of Infectious Diseases Epidemiology, Centre for Epidemiology and Microbiology at the National Institute of Public Health. This institute is also an EPIET training site acknowledged by the European Centre for Disease Prevention and Control (ECDC). In this brief report, I will outline my experience with the program and provide some necessary information to potential programme applicants.

As part of the European HERA grant, which SZU received in September 2021, the technical and personal capacity of some laboratories for sequencing the SARS-CoV-2 virus in the Czech Republic (CZ) was increased. The text is a summary of basic information on SARS-CoV-2 variants sequenced in CZ for the period December 2021 – April 2022. Detailed reports were published on 18 August 2022 on the SZU website.

The growth dynamics of Lactobacillus acidophilus 145 and Lb. rhamnosus GG in substrate prepared from buckwheat, water or milk, sucrose or flavoring compound (vanilla and chocolate) was investigated. In general, during the fermentation (numbers at the end have reached values from 1.8?108 to 3.4?109 cfu g1) or storage (Nfinal from 1.8?108 to 3.3?109 cfu g1), the growth of individual strain was satisfactory. According to the evaluation of overall taste, the substrate with vanilla flavor and water, fermented by Lb. rhamnosus GG for 24 h and stored for 5 days, obtained the highest number of points. Lactobacilli had slightly cytotoxic effect on the HeLa cells and Caco-2 cells, and the percentage of inhibition after 48 and 72 h of exposure ranged from 40 to 96 % for both selected strains.

INTRODUCTION: The completeness and timeliness of the pertussis questionnaire-based enhanced surveillance system (ESS) among infants and reported pertussis data within the electronic nationwide notification system (NNS) in the years 2015, 2017 and 2019 were evaluated in a pilot study. METHODS: The completeness of the variables for demographic characteristics, date of symptom onset, hospitalisation and vaccination status were assessed in both systems. Timeliness of reporting in the NNS was analysed as the interval between symptom onset and a) the date of first specimen collection (diagnostic delay), and b) the date of the Regional Public Health Authority receiving notification (notification delay). RESULTS: A total of 121 confirmed pertussis cases were reported to the NNS in the study years, while in the ESS a total of 104 confirmed cases were reported in infants. In both systems most cases were in the age group of one completed month of life (20% versus 23%) and males (55% versus 55%). The majority of cases were hospitalised (81% versus 85%) and unvaccinated (77% versus 78%). Within the NNS, the first dose of vaccine was reported in 13 cases, the second dose in 11, and third dose in three cases. Within the NNS, 100% completeness of following variables was found: symptom onset, week and region of reporting, age, gender and place of isolation. Median diagnostic delay was nine days. Median notification delay was 18 days. CONCLUSIONS: Data completeness was high in the NNS, except for lack of vaccination data in those eligible by age. Efforts to improve the completeness of laboratory-related variables and timeliness are essential. Based on the study results, the project of improving the ESS for infants will continue with regular evaluation.
